Dental implants have turn out to be a well-liked resolution for those who are missing teeth, providing a reliable and aesthetically pleasing alternative to dentures and bridges. Understanding the dental implants process step-by-step might help potential sufferers put together for the journey ahead.
The preliminary session performs a crucial role in the course of. During this assembly, the dentist assesses the affected person's oral health via imaging strategies like X-rays and 3D scans. Additionally, an in depth dental historical past is taken to understand any underlying conditions which may affect the process.
Once it is decided that dental implants are a viable option, the remedy plan is developed (Mono Dental Implants Recovery Time). This plan usually outlines the variety of implants needed, the sort of implant to be used, and the expected timeframe for the complete course of. Factors similar to bone density and gum health are additionally taken under consideration throughout this part
Following the treatment planning, the next step is the surgical procedure to position the dental implants. This is often carried out beneath native anesthesia, which helps to minimize discomfort. The first step in the surgery is to prepare the jawbone by creating an area for the implant.

A titanium publish, which serves as the root of the new tooth, is inserted into the ready area within the jaw. This post is designed to fuse with the bone in a process known as osseointegration. This critical section can take a number of months, permitting the bone to develop around and safe the implant.
Once osseointegration is complete, a therapeutic cap is placed on the implant - Mono Dental Implants And Tooth Extraction. This cap helps to protect the implant site through the healing part. Patients are suggested to observe particular care directions to ensure proper healing and to avoid any complications

After the therapeutic cap stage, an abutment is attached to the implant. This part connects the implant to the prosthetic tooth. The dentist may take impressions of the mouth during this appointment to create a custom-made crown that matches seamlessly with the encircling teeth.
Following the impression, the dental laboratory fabricates the crown. This customized crown is made to look just like a natural tooth, making certain that aesthetics and performance are each preserved. Once it is prepared, a subsequent appointment is scheduled for the ultimate placement.
During this appointment, the crown is attached to the abutment, completing the dental implant restoration process. The dentist will make any necessary adjustments to ensure a correct fit and chew. After this step, patients can start to take pleasure in the benefits of their new teeth.

- Initial consultation includes a complete dental examination, including X-rays or 3D imaging to gauge bone structure and assess affected person eligibility for implants.
- Treatment planning is developed based on the evaluation, which outlines the particular implant sort, placement technique, and any necessary preparatory procedures.
- An extraction may be carried out if the tooth is not salvageable, involving the removal of the broken tooth earlier than the implant can be placed.
- Bone grafting could additionally be needed if there could be inadequate bone density, selling new bone development to help the implant effectively.
- Local anesthesia or sedation choices are administered to ensure affected person comfort through the implant placement procedure.
- The titanium implant post is surgically inserted into the jawbone, serving as a strong foundation for the bogus tooth.
- A therapeutic period follows the place osseointegration happens, allowing the bone to safe and fuse with the implant, typically lasting several months.
- An abutment is placed on the implant once therapeutic is full, serving as a connector between the implant and the ultimate prosthetic tooth.
- Custom impressions are taken to create a crown that matches the affected person's natural teeth, guaranteeing proper match and appearance.
